More than the story itself which is quite good, what i loved the most about it was fujimoto himself, in particular his writing and overall talent as a mangaka. He's just too good at paneling, his manga is always so cinematic, you can tell he's a huge movie nerd without even knowing him all that well, and for the type of stories he tells the cinematic approach fits. Chainsaw man reads like a full length movie, with its strengths and weaknesses. I love how easy flowing it is, it lends itself well to multiple re-reads, the pacing is really fast and the story is entertaining all the way through,there's lot of creative paneling, the action is tight, flashy and gory, the power system is interesting, the cast is overall good and certainly memorable, thanks to fujimoto's ability to greatly understand and lay out characters that feel human, i love that batshit insanity that is present in all his works and i guess is his trademark lol. The story is nothing truly groundbreaking, the premise reminds me a lot of devilman and for a good 5 volumes follows that linear, monster of the week progression that slowly entroduces you to the world, characters and the stakes in place, but its with the latter volumes that chainsaw man shines to me, especially volumes 6, 8, 9, 11. Volume 6 in particular to me was my favorite part of it all, presenting a short love story between denji and reze (my favorite character) that feels so real and intimate, all told in 9 chapters, in which there's also an amazing battle. Truly his biggest strength is telling stories about the human condition that stick with you using only a few chapters, like he does with his one shots (goodbye eri being my favorite). The ending was bizarre but fitting with the story and fujimoto's style so i really enjoyed it. The biggest weaknesses have to be part of the cast, notably himeno, who unfortunately i didnt feel too sad about her death because of the lack of proper screen time, most of the killers and kishibe, and the pacing that yes, i did note as a positive overall, but towards the end kinda made it all flow too quickly, not leaving imo enough time to stomach everything that happened in the last 3 volumes. 3, arguably 4 very important things happened (gun devil, what was thought to be the antagonist of the story, so a huge deal, aki's death, the reveal of makima as the true enemy and the true identity of chainsaw man) all happened in such a close proximity that some of them had less of an impact than i hoped. Aki's death tho was executed perfectly, thanks to fujimoto's amazing cinematic direction, so at least that wasnt ruined.
Overall i enjoyed it a lot, but ironically what i loved the most was seeing this man getting better and better at his art, and god the expectations for part 2 are through the roof, since he'll be published in jump+ which im sure will let him go even wilder with his imagination.
Im somewhat both scared and hyped for the manga fujimoto will be making in 5/10 years, he has immense potential.

That was a way to come back lol, chapter didnt show the protagonist but the likely antagonist instead. Found interesting that it starts with the teacher wanting his students to empathize with the devil, that didnt seem to be the case in part 1, so maybe chainsaw man, and by association denji and his whole belief of devils that should be treated as humans if they are friendly, may have swayed public opinion on them. Seems mitaka doesnt like the way denji has changed society, since it seems its implied the corruption she speaks on is caused by him. Bucky being introduced and f***ing dying a stupid death like 10 pages later was funny. Mitaka is interesting, she hates devils, apparently because they caused her parents' death, but i think there's more to it, although i cant pinpoint what it could be. She seems to be insecure, or at the very least she hates herself and projects that hate to others, especially those who to her seem to have all she couldnt. But the revelation at the end that she was not that different from the others, that everyone has someone they're jealous of, right at the last 0.1 seconds of her life, was dope; loved especially the paneling of that page (Pg 38). It seems she has a sense of law and order, since she follows the law even when not needed, which may be connected to why she hates chainsaw man. She like denji gets a second chance at life, only this time she may be subjugated to the war devil, unlike denji's contract which is basically the opposite. War devil is probably one of the 4 horsemen makima was talking about, and its looking for chainsaw man. Very interesting she mentions nuclear bombs, since according to makima it was forgotten by people thanks to chainsaw man's powers
Just noticed she wants csm to VOMIT BACK UP nuclear weapons, this devil is a menace, because that means she wants all the weapon devils chainsaw ate up to power herself up, since war logically would be powered up by them
